Output 3cdf7988eb196bd57bc7b70e7a9dd96f045c4c4f5dd21c3925ef5186b5f6b409:22

value
6950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757b7239062638400490fa7c658b794bb7efb11b OP_EQUAL
address
3CQCsBLaMH7VA74ZCG6XFjw5qzqXZHUQJ9
transaction
3cdf7988eb196bd57bc7b70e7a9dd96f045c4c4f5dd21c3925ef5186b5f6b409
confirmations
343000
spent
true